Absolut Mess
If you ever need good food inside an old inn and sit fully protected behind thick stone walls and have nice conversations - go to Sergeantsville Inn. It is not only a great restaurant, they also have the Absolut Mess drink there, based on a recipe we haven't been able to figure out. They told us the ingredients (Absolut Citron, Mandarin and Kurant, cranberry juice and lime). It is very good when you order it here (less so at our house, wonder what is wrong when we make it). In the photo, the mess is in the front and a glass of Chardonnay in the back. This is in the tavern part, they also have a restaurant part with really nice tables. We took EH here during her visit and we had some fantastic food! They have homemade grappa too, and make a fantastic calamari appetizer.
